If she had known about what he thought--the desire to have a coat like hers, the stars glittering lightly against her navy and gold body--she would have laughed. Little did he know about the tortures she endured because of such, a thing she couldn't control. If she had a choice, she wouldn't want the flashy, unique coloration or the softly twinkling markings. She was stolen and sold into slavery because of it; that, despite all the world had taken away from her, was never something she could forget. The only thing it had accomplished was to make her scared, afraid of all with horns like the unicorns that slipped her into their chains. It was a mark she would forever carry with her, unsure if the fear would ever leave her heart.

So, for the time spent between then and where she was at that moment, she sought only the plain or winged company; she wasn't quite ready to face her nightmares.
She supposed such was shown quite clearly with her abandonment of retrieving her memories.

She hadn't quite expected the unwelcoming the stallion had given her. She watched his pinned ears and his effort to get up; had she made him feel like he needed to stand, to protect himself from her? That was also a thought she would have brushed away with a laugh, for surely she could not even harm a fly. She was built delicately and though used to toiling under a brutal sun for hours without rest, she knew nothing of fighting. Yet the rather displeased man did not deter her from staying near, gazing upon him with a certain curiosity in her golden eyes. She surely was biased, as though if a unicorn had dared to regard her as such she would have turned and taken flight--but being only another with wings, she didn't fear any physically rebuttal from him.

She merely left a wry smile on her lips at his attitude, standing back and cocking one hoof while she rested there. "My, you know how to draw one in for company." Her voice was teasing, light. She found herself to be in good spirits, and she definitely wasn't going to let the feeling go easily. Her gold-tipped ears were kept forward whereas his sat flatly against his skull. "I came to explore these lands; is one not allowed to stop for a hello with a stranger?" It was clear that he was in a foul mood, but she knew it couldn't have anything to do with her. They had just met, after all, and she had but spoken her name.

She tentatively took some steps forward to reach her neck out, muzzle extended to him in greeting. She held her breath, wondering if he would accept the gesture.
